Jolie then explained that Marcheline passed away 15 years ago.

It was “after a long battle with breast and ovarian cancer,” the humanitarian worker noted.

“In June, I’m a month away from being diagnosed,” she said.

“I’ve had preventative surgeries to try and reduce the odds, but I’m continuing with checkups,” the Those Who Wish Me Dead star wrote.

Jolie underwent a double mastectomy in 2013 to avoid developing breast cancer.

It was what’s called a prophylactic double mastectomy. That means she had both breasts removed, even though she had not been diagnosed with breast cancer. She said she did this because she carries a gene called BRCA1, which significantly increases the chance of developing breast or ovarian cancer.
